- I'm using a 2.5GHz PC and even at 192kHz sampling rate and other programs
running I'm using about 35% of the CPU. I do have the Mercury application set
as Real Time though. If I drag the GUI all over the screen as fast as I can the
CPU runs at 100% but does not drop audio.
